Job description
Job Summary

We are looking for a Mechanical Assistant to join our hard‑working Estate team. As a Mechanical Assistant you will assist in the provision of a high‑quality, efficient, responsive, flexible & effective estates service to Salisbury NHS Foundation Trust. You will be part of a multi‑disciplined team within Estates reporting to the Estates Officer (Operational).

Responsibilities
  • Manage your own allocated workload.
  • Work unsupervised during maintenance duties, including responding to out‑of‑hour requests as part of the Estates on‑call service.
  • Flush water outlets and support senior maintenance staff with routine water testing and sampling activities to maintain compliance with ACOP L8.
  • Perform minor plumbing and mechanical tasks and assist building trades where appropriate, while understanding the operation of building services in NHS buildings to maintain safe and efficient operation.
  • Carry out Planned Preventative Maintenance (PPM): follow PPM schedules, complete necessary report sheets and test certificates, and update Plant Room Log Books.
  • Work under departmental precedents and clearly defined occupational policies, protocols, SOPs and codes of conduct. Work is supervised and results/outcomes are assessed at agreed intervals; senior Estates Officers are available for reference.

Essential Qualifications
  • Recognised and registered EITB, City & Guilds, modern apprenticeship, NVQ Level 3 or approved equivalent training in Mechanical/Electrical Engineering or Plumbing.
  • Demonstrable in‑depth knowledge and experience within the required technical disciplines (e.g. BMS, decontamination etc.).
  • Knowledge of operation / maintenance / fault‑finding / repair / diagnostics, testing and installation work associated with complex electrical and electronic installations and equipment in an economic, efficient and safe manner.
  • Knowledge of application of Health & Safety legislation, ACOPs, guidance and rules, NHS technical standards (e.g. Health Technical Memoranda), Trust policies, basic life support and emergency aid; readiness to train where required.
Desirable Qualifications
  • Commitment to customer care.
  • Ability to be part of an out‑of‑hours on‑call rota.
  • Specialist knowledge gained from working in a healthcare engineering environment or willingness to develop it.
  • IT literacy or willingness to train to ECDL Level 2 (Microsoft Office); knowledge or readiness to undertake training on Trust’s computer‑based asset and condition‑based maintenance management system.
